We moved into our new building in December and are slowly running out of options. My wife cannot sleep because of the noises. The plumbing company has no clue and refuses to come. It all started after moving in; the heating circuit distributor was very noisy and could even be heard in the bedroom. We then called our plumbing company, which still hasn’t completed all the work, and informed them. After they finally came after a month, they just turned the Wilo pump down to level 1, speed 1, and the boss said it should be quiet now. It did improve somewhat from then on but was still audible. Then, about two weeks ago, it got louder again, even though nothing was changed. We even lowered the Bosch Compress 7000i AWMB at night to make it quieter. But from that point on, it didn’t help at all. Meanwhile, the Bosch customer service came as well but unfortunately couldn’t do anything either. He said we should get an expert because we have to live with the noise since the pipes are probably too narrow, or he suspects constrictions or bent hoses. When the valve on the HKV was closed, everything was quiet. On Saturday, another plumber came to help us. He said you only have problems when the flow rate is at 1 liter. We had a hydraulic balancing done for the KfW, but it has been adjusted 10 times by now. The plumbing company that installed everything also changed it again. The circuits were then between 0.8 and 1.5 liters depending on the length. Bosch customer service told us that this is also how it is supposed to be done. The other plumber who was here said he sets all the flow rates to 2 liters. The noise was now barely noticeable, but now the Wilo pump is whistling; it sounds like a tinnitus noise. It is terrible. We don’t know if it was already there before, and we just didn’t notice it so much because of the noise from the tiles. But now it is there, even at the lowest Wilo pump setting. (Para 25-130/8-75) What else can be done now, or what should I advise the plumber? He is clueless himself. Do I even have a chance against such noises with an expert?
